应用圆二色光谱研究电场对辣根过氧化物酶二级结构的影响

摘    要:辣根过氧化物酶(HRP)经不同强度的电场处理,用圆二色光谱研究了电场对辣根过氧化物酶二级结构的影响.结果表明:在1.0~6.0 kV·cm-1范围,不同强度的电场对辣根过氧化物酶的α-螺旋、β-折叠、β-转角及无规卷曲相对含量的影响程度不同.与对照组相比,处理组的α-螺旋、β-转角和无规卷曲含量降低,降幅范围分别为0.3%~11.4%,1.7%~15.3%和0.9%~20.4%;β-折叠含量增加,增幅范围为0.9%~82.7%.电场作用具有使辣根过氧化物酶的二级结构中α-螺旋、β-转角和无规卷曲向β-折叠转化的趋势.研究结果对解释电场处理种子生物效应具有重要意义.

Study on the Effect of Electric Field on the Secondary Structure of HRP by Circular Dichroism

Abstract:After the HRP was treated with different strength of electric field, the effect of electric field on the secondary structure of HRP was studied by circular dichroism. The results show that different electric field strength ranging from 1.0 to 6.0 kV x cm(-1) has a different effect on the relative contents of alpha-helix, beta-sheet, beta-turn and random coil of the HRP. As compared with the contrast, the relative contents of alpha-helix, beta-turn and random coil decreased by 0.3%-11.4%, 1.7%-15.3% and 0.9%-20.4% respectively, while beta-sheet content increased by 0.9%-82.7%. The electric treatment tends to transform the alpha-helix, beta-turn and random coil into beta-sheet for the HRP. The result of this study has important meaning to explain the biological effect of electric treatment seeds.
